Leakage damper valves are devices used in HVAC systems to control the flow of air and reduce unwanted leaks. They help improve energy efficiency and enhance indoor air quality by ensuring that conditioned air is properly circulated without unnecessary loss. Different environments require different leakage damper valve types. For instance, a commercial building might need a more robust option to handle larger air volumes compared to a residential unit. Customers often struggle with understanding which type fits their specific needs.
Many customers purchase valves that are either too large or too small for their systems. Proper sizing is essential to avoid air pressure problems and inefficiencies. For instance, a valve that’s too small may lead to increased air velocity, causing noise and wear on the system, while one that’s too large might not effectively control airflow.

According to a report by the American Society of Heating, Refrigerating and Air-Conditioning Engineers (ASHRAE), up to 30% of energy used in commercial buildings can be attributed to leaks in HVAC systems. A well-chosen leakage damper valve helps mitigate this by ensuring that air does not escape unnecessarily.
In one case study, a manufacturing facility replaced existing dampers with properly sized leakage damper valves, resulting in a 15% reduction in energy costs over six months. This not only paid for the new valves but also significantly improved indoor air quality, leading to happier and healthier employees.
